Awarded by QUALIFI Ltd, this 120 credits diploma is designed to equip students with the knowledge and skills necessary to succeed in strategic management and leadership roles.

Key Modules and Skills

Meanwhile, the diploma consists of several key modules. These include Manage Team Performance to Support Strategy, Information Management and Strategic Decision Taking, and Leading a Strategic Management Project.
